Ksente Bogoev is a human[1]. His place of birth was Strumica[2]. He was born on October 20, 1919[3]. He passed away in Skopje[4]. He died on April 20, 2008[5]. He worked as an economist[6], political commissar[7], university teacher[8], and politician[9]. Body
Origins and Family
Ksente Bogoev's place of birth was Strumica[2]. He was born on October 20, 1919[3].
Education
Ksente Bogoev was educated at University of Belgrade[18]. He earned the academic degree of Doctor of Economics[25].
Career and Affiliations
Recorded occupations include economist[6], political commissar[7], university teacher[8], and politician[9]. Fields of work include economics[12], an academic discipline[28]; finance[13], an academic discipline[29]; monetary policy[14], a type of policy[30]; and fiscal policy[15], a type of policy[31]. Among Ksente Bogoev's employers was Ss. Cyril and Methodius University of Skopje[17]. He held the position of Prime Minister of North Macedonia[16].
Recognition
Ksente Bogoev received the Order of Merit for Macedonia[19].
Personal Life
Ksente Bogoev was affiliated with the League of Communists of Macedonia[23].
Death and Burial
Ksente Bogoev died on April 20, 2008[5]. He passed away in Skopje[4].
